Frequently Asked Questions
- Q: What are the main features of the Pfister Rosslyn Kitchen Faucet? A: The Pfister Rosslyn Kitchen Faucet features a pull-down sprayer with a toggle button for spray or stream modes, a high arc spout for added clearance, and an advanced spray head docking system. It also includes a coordinating soap dispenser and is NSF certified for lead-free plumbing.
- Q: Is the Pfister Rosslyn Kitchen Faucet easy to install? A: Yes, the faucet is designed for quick installation with Pfast Connect technology, which simplifies the connection to water supply lines. It comes with a Quick Install Tool to speed up the installation process.
- Q: What materials is the Pfister Rosslyn Kitchen Faucet made from? A: The Pfister Rosslyn Kitchen Faucet is primarily made from metal, ensuring durability and a quality finish.
- Q: Does the faucet come with a warranty? A: Yes, the Pfister Rosslyn Kitchen Faucet comes with a limited lifetime warranty, covering both finish and function as long as you own your home.
- Q: Can I use the soap dispenser with any type of liquid soap? A: Yes, the SoloTilt soap dispenser is designed to work with most liquid soaps, making it versatile for kitchen use.
- Q: How does the advanced spray head docking system work? A: The advanced spray head docking system uses MagnePfit technology, which employs powerful magnets to securely hold the spray head in place, ensuring it aligns correctly after use.
- Q: What is the height and reach of the spout? A: The faucet features a high arc spout, providing additional clearance and reach for various kitchen tasks, such as hand washing and cleaning large pots.
- Q: Is the faucet suitable for a 1 or 3-hole installation? A: Yes, the faucet can be installed in either 1 or 3-hole configurations, making it compatible with a variety of sink setups.
- Q: How do I clean and maintain the faucet? A: To maintain the faucet, use a soft cloth and mild soap. The wipe-clean nozzles allow you to easily remove mineral deposits by simply wiping them with your finger.
- Q: What does NSF certified mean for this faucet? A: NSF certification indicates that the faucet conforms to lead content requirements for 'lead-free' plumbing, ensuring safe drinking water as defined by various state laws and the U.S. Safe Drinking Water Act.
